The Impact of Major Sporting Events on Consumer Behavior
Major sporting events, such as the Olympic Games, FIFA World Cup, or the Super Bowl, attract millions of viewers worldwide. These events foster a shared sense of excitement and community, prompting consumers to participate actively in related purchasing decisions. For instance, during the FIFA World Cup, brands often introduce limited-edition products, special discounts, or themed advertising campaigns that capitalize on the heightened excitement. The synchronization of marketing efforts around these events ensures better visibility and consumer recall.
Aligning Promotions with Sporting Calendars: A Tactical Approach
| Strategy Aspect | Implementation Details |
|---|---|
| Pre-Event Building | Launching teaser campaigns and early discounts to generate anticipation before the event begins. |
| During the Event | Real-time promotions tied to ongoing matches or milestones reinforce engagement and drive immediate sales. |
| Post-Event Engagement | Follow-up offers capitalizing on the event's momentum, such as commemorative merchandise or discount codes related to popular moments. |
Case Studies Demonstrating Effective Timing
For example, a sports apparel company might launch a campaign featuring discounts on fan gear just as a major tournament kicks off, amplifying their visibility among sports enthusiasts. Similarly, hospitality venues often align their promotional packages with championship finals, offering ticket bundles or themed experiences to capitalize on the event's peak interest. These strategies are most potent when well-synchronized with the scheduled dates of tournaments and matches.
The Role of Digital Platforms in Synchronizing Promotions
Contemporary digital marketing platforms enable precise timing and targeting, ensuring that promotional content aligns seamlessly with sporting schedules. Social media campaigns, email marketing, and targeted ads can be scheduled around key moments, enhancing their relevance and impact. Tools such as analytics dashboards further assist marketers in evaluating campaign performance in real time, allowing for optimal adjustment of promotional tactics.
